From b8d87d1addb79021bae1a2c045040988aab8ea63 Mon Sep 17 00:00:00 2001 From: songferngwang Date: Thu, 29 Feb 2024 07:07:24 +0000 Subject: [PATCH] Modify the condition for hide Dds confirmed dialog Bug: 318310357 Bug: 298898436 Bug: 298891941 Test: manual test and verify the UI. Change-Id: I68df36b457ea7479cd6a561f9c2b3c968e14fe44 --- src/com/android/settings/network/SimOnboardingActivity.kt | 2 +- src/com/android/settings/sim/SimDialogActivity.java | 4 +--- 2 files changed, 2 insertions(+), 4 deletions(-) diff --git a/src/com/android/settings/network/SimOnboardingActivity.kt b/src/com/android/settings/network/SimOnboardingActivity.kt index 6347d7b62f4..b4b2cd06418 100644 --- a/src/com/android/settings/network/SimOnboardingActivity.kt +++ b/src/com/android/settings/network/SimOnboardingActivity.kt @@ -102,7 +102,7 @@ class SimOnboardingActivity : SpaBaseDialogActivity() { if (onboardingService.activeSubInfoList.isEmpty()) { // TODO: refactor and replace the ToggleSubscriptionDialogActivity - Log.e(TAG, "onboardingService.activeSubInfoList is empty" + + Log.d(TAG, "onboardingService.activeSubInfoList is empty" + ", start ToggleSubscriptionDialogActivity") this.startActivity(ToggleSubscriptionDialogActivity .getIntent(this.applicationContext, targetSubId, true)) diff --git a/src/com/android/settings/sim/SimDialogActivity.java b/src/com/android/settings/sim/SimDialogActivity.java index 4544e73b87d..8840994b366 100644 --- a/src/com/android/settings/sim/SimDialogActivity.java +++ b/src/com/android/settings/sim/SimDialogActivity.java @@ -136,9 +136,7 @@ public class SimDialogActivity extends FragmentActivity { } if (Flags.isDualSimOnboardingEnabled() - && getProgressState() == SubscriptionActionDialogActivity.PROGRESS_IS_SHOWING - && (dialogType == PREFERRED_PICK - || dialogType == DATA_PICK + && (dialogType == DATA_PICK || dialogType == CALLS_PICK || dialogType == SMS_PICK)) { Log.d(TAG, "Finish the sim dialog since the sim onboarding is shown");